Paper Doll Diary: Dress Up DIY - Play Online

If you ever spent your childhood cutting out paper dolls from magazines and dressing them up, this is basically that—but on your phone with way more glitter. Paper Doll Diary: Dress Up DIY is a pure fashion sandbox where you dress up customizable dolls, decorate their rooms, and collect outfits like they're Pokémon cards. The goal? Build the ultimate wardrobe, style your character however you want, and fill a virtual dollhouse with cute furniture. It's creativity-focused gameplay with zero pressure and zero skill required.

Key Features

    • Massive Wardrobe: Over 1000 clothing items, accessories, hairstyles, and makeup options to mix and match.
    • Room Decoration Mode: Furnish multiple rooms (bedroom, bathroom, kitchen) with drag-and-drop furniture placement.
    • Paper Doll Aesthetic: Clean 2D vector art style with a nostalgic notebook-themed UI that looks like a scrapbook.
    • Collection-Based Progression: Unlock new items using in-game currency (diamonds) and expand your customization options over time.

How to Play Paper Doll Diary: Dress Up DIY

It's dead simple—there's no way to lose, and you can't mess anything up. This is pure creative expression with training wheels.

Dress Your Doll Using the Wardrobe

You start by picking your base character, then head into the wardrobe screen. The interface looks like a spiral notebook with tabs for different outfit categories—tops, bottoms, dresses, shoes, accessories, hair, makeup. You just tap an item to instantly equip it on your doll. The drag-and-drop tutorial showed up once for me, but honestly, tapping is faster. Mix a school uniform blazer with goth boots if you want. Nobody's judging.

Decorate Your Dollhouse Rooms

Switch to room decoration mode and you get a grid-based dollhouse view split into different zones. You scroll through furniture categories at the bottom (beds, tables, plants, wall decorations) and tap to place them. Some items have little orange premium tags—those cost extra diamonds or might be locked behind ads. The green highlight shows what you've selected, and you can rearrange everything as many times as you want. It's like The Sims but with zero autonomy or chaos.

Earn Currency and Unlock More Stuff

The diamond counter sits in the top corner, taunting you with all the locked content. You earn currency slowly through daily logins or by watching ad videos (the classic mobile game trade-off). The core loop is just: unlock item → equip item → take screenshot → repeat. There's no story mode or challenges that I encountered—it's purely about the dopamine hit of collecting new outfits and seeing your room fill up.

Who is Paper Doll Diary: Dress Up DIY for?

This is 100% aimed at younger kids—probably ages 6 to 13—who want a safe, stress-free creative outlet on a tablet or phone. If you loved Gacha Life, Lily Diary, or those old Flash dress-up games from the early 2000s, you'll recognize the vibe instantly. It's perfect for short bursts of play during car rides or while half-watching TV. Adults might find it a little too simplistic unless you're into ultra-casual collection games or just need something mindless to unwind with.

The Gameplay Vibe

This is the digital equivalent of organizing your sock drawer while listening to lo-fi music. Zero stress, zero stakes. The visual style is bright and cute with lots of pastel pinks, rounded fonts, and sparkle particle effects that pop up whenever you equip something. The graphics are simple—flat 2D vector art with basic gradients and no fancy lighting. It honestly looks like a mobile game from 2015, but that's not necessarily bad if you're into the kawaii aesthetic. There's no background music that I noticed, just little UI clicks and chimes. It's very quiet, almost ASMR-like in how chill it is.

Technical Check: Saves & Performance

The game auto-saves your progress in your browser cache, so as long as you don't clear your cookies or play in incognito mode, your outfits and room setups will stick around. Performance-wise, this runs butter-smooth even on older phones or low-end PCs because the graphics are so simple. It's built in Unity but optimized for mobile-first play, so expect fast load times and no lag. The UI responds instantly to taps, which is good since the whole experience is menu-based.

Controls

Everything is point-and-click or tap-based. The UI is very responsive, though some of the furniture placement felt a bit finicky on desktop with a mouse.

    • Desktop: Mouse to click and drag items. Scroll with the mouse wheel through menus.
    • Mobile: Tap to select and equip. Swipe to browse categories. Drag-and-drop for room decoration (though tapping works just as well).
